Most of all the ENDING, which is a big let-down. I don't think I'm giving anything away when I say that the last mission (#240 or so) is just a one-on-one against a German plane, D.VII if memory serves. I had well over 200 kills by this point, so this wasn't any kind of challenge at all. (Earlier in the game, in the only other solo mission you're sent on, you get jumped by seven planes. I shot them all down without taking any hits. I should be afraid of one plane?) I also thought that while the journal was a nice touch, it was TOO impersonal. They could have livened it up a little, I think. (I really didn't like being told how terrified I was during Bloody April, when I already had more kills than Richthofen would ever get.) I especially didn't care for the way the journal would just pick up like nothing happened after your pilot was killed and you replaced him with a new one. And I didn't like the way my pilot's head became a "blind spot"- enemy planes would get in front of me and I couldn't see them because my head was in the way! It's a good game, and I recommend it to anyone interested in WW I air combat. The journal gives you a sense of living through the war. But despite what the box says, it is NOT a role-playing game of any kind, so if that's what you're looking for, stay away. PS- it was dirty pool not to mention in the docs the scenes where you try to evade the German plane on your tail from a back view of your plane.
